Cracked foundation repair services involve assessing and addressing damage to the structural base of a property. These services typically include identifying the extent and cause of foundation issues, followed by implementing appropriate solutions such as underpinning, slabjacking, or pier installation. The goal is to stabilize the foundation and restore the integrity of the building’s structure. Professionals use specialized equipment and techniques to ensure that repairs are durable and effective, helping to prevent further damage or deterioration over time.

This service is essential for solving problems related to foundation settlement, cracking, and shifting. Common signs indicating the need for foundation repair include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that no longer close properly. Addressing these issues promptly can help prevent more extensive damage to the property’s walls, framing, and overall stability. Foundation repair services aim to correct these problems, thereby maintaining the safety and longevity of the building.

Properties that typically require cracked foundation repair services include residential homes, especially older or poorly constructed structures, as well as commercial buildings and multi-family complexes. Homes built on expansive soils or in areas prone to soil movement are particularly susceptible to foundation issues. Additionally, properties that have experienced water damage, improper drainage, or shifting ground may benefit from foundation stabilization and repair services to ensure their structural soundness.

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for cracked foundation repair can range from $2,500 to $7,500, depending on the extent of damage and repair methods used. Minor cracks may cost less, while extensive foundation work can increase expenses significantly.

Material and Method Expenses - The choice of repair materials and techniques influences the overall cost, with epoxy injections averaging around $1,000 to $3,000 for small cracks. Larger or more complex repairs may require underpinning or stabilization, which can cost upwards of $10,000.

Labor and Service Fees - Labor costs for foundation repair services typically range from $50 to $150 per hour, with total project costs reflecting the complexity and size of the foundation. Service providers may charge a flat fee or hourly rates based on the scope of work.

Cost Variability Factors - Prices vary depending on the foundation type, soil conditions, and local market rates. For example, repairs in Fallbrook, CA, may fall within a specific range, but unique site conditions can influence overall expenses significantly.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Cracked Foundation Repair services involve local contractors diagnosing and fixing foundation cracks caused by settling or shifting, helping to restore structural stability. They utilize techniques such as epoxy injections or underpinning to address specific issues.

Foundation Stabilization projects focus on preventing further movement by reinforcing the existing foundation structure, often through soil stabilization methods or pier installation. Local pros assess site conditions to recommend appropriate solutions.

Foundation Piering services are used to lift and stabilize sunken foundations by installing piers beneath the structure, providing added support in areas with shifting soil conditions. Contractors tailor solutions to the foundation’s needs.

Basement Wall Repair involves fixing cracks, bowing, or bulging basement walls to prevent further damage and water intrusion, often through wall reinforcement or reinforcement systems installed by local specialists.

Concrete Slab Repair services address uneven or cracked concrete slabs caused by soil movement, with solutions such as mudjacking or slab replacement provided by nearby contractors.

Waterproofing and Drainage Solutions are often recommended alongside foundation repairs to prevent moisture-related issues that can exacerbate foundation problems, with local providers offering tailored waterproofing services.

What are common signs of a cracked foundation?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sagging floors, and gaps around windows or doors.

How can foundation cracks affect a home? Cracks can lead to structural issues, water intrusion, and decreased property value if not addressed promptly.

What repair options are available for cracked foundations? Local service providers may offer methods such as epoxy injections, underpinning, or wall stabilization depending on the severity of the cracks.

Is foundation repair a DIY project? Foundation repair typically requires professional expertise to ensure proper assessment and safe, effective solutions.

How long does foundation repair usually take? The duration varies based on the extent of the damage and the repair method, with local pros providing assessments for specific cases.
